Iran now tightens the security of all nuclear workers following the murder of a nuclear scientist last week. Security was ordered by the President of Iran Mahmoud Ahmadinejad.

“Anyone who is active in the nuclear field will be placed in a special supervision,” said Vice President Mohammad Reza Rahimi.

According to ISNA that quotes Rahimi, a special surveillance measures have been ordered 10 months ago against Iran’s nuclear scientists.

“But this time, the Government ordered that anyone who is active in the nuclear field, ranging from low level to the top level, will be in the supervision and got special treatment,” said Rahimi.

This command is issued after Mostafa Ahmadi Roshan, was killed in a bomb explosion taped to his car. Deputy Director of the uranium enrichment facility in Natanz nuclear project was killed along with his driver in an incident in Teheran on 11 January.

The attack was the fifth attack which targets scientists Iran in the past two years. Four other scientists Iran, three of which are involved in Iran’s nuclear program, were killed in the bomb attacks. Iran officials called the attacks it is covert operations by Israel and the United States.
